Right now if a science frame doesn't have any calibration data with it when the entire program ID dataset is downloaded that science observation will be skipped. This is essentially because the calibrations directory wouldn't be created. However, we might be able to make this more robust by adding a failover option here. It remains to be seen how many programs this affects, or even if the right choice here is to use calibrations from a day ahead or behind.
